Output 574fd887b83c72a6397d978350a51bc03f53a74995895f49a608f5589418fc6f:0

value
12844652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 103badc319c02dfe7c01865b3bda87c4f86d845d OP_EQUAL
address
33ArEAaCTxBiHrkxFnUzgQmXwH39PxB7Uc
transaction
574fd887b83c72a6397d978350a51bc03f53a74995895f49a608f5589418fc6f
spent
true